1 Leslie P. Evans Chapter of TEXAS ASSOCIATION FOR SUPERVISION AND CURRICULUM DEVELOPMENT Constitution and By-Laws Preamble The educators in Region XI of the Education Service Center, in order to promote educational leadership and instructional improvement, do hereby join to form the Leslie P. Evans Chapter of the Texas Association for Supervision and Curriculum Development. ARTICLE I NAME The name of this organization shall be Leslie P. Evans Chapter of the Texas Association for Supervision and Curriculum Development, a chapter of the national Association for Supervision and Curriculum Development. Dr. Leslie P. Evans, longtime Texas Christian University educator who died in 1982, was instrumental in nurturing this unit as the first local chapter of Texas Association for Supervision and Curriculum Development. ARTICLE II PURPOSE The purpose of this organization shall be the promotion of curriculum study; the improvement of instruction and supervision; the stimulation of professional growth; the increased collaboration among members to promote effective problem-solving solutions of school related issues and challenges; and the encouragement of active participation in the stat TX ASCD organization. ARTICLE III MEMBERSHIP Persons involved in supervision and curriculum development or related areas, upon payment of dues as herein provided, shall become members of the Leslie P. Evans Chapter of the Texas Association for Supervision and Curriculum Development. Membership in the Texas and national Association for Supervision and Curriculum Development shall be encouraged and promoted.
2 Any member shall be entitled to vote, hold office, participate in discussions and otherwise receive such benefits and materials, as may be forthcoming from the Association. ARTICLE IV OFFICERS AND EXECUTIVE COMMITTEE The officers of the Association shall consist of a president, vice president, secretary, treasurer, and the immediate past-president. These officers, together with the chairs of the standing committees, shall constitute the executive committee. The treasurer shall be an employee of the ESC 11 staff and have the administrative authority to oversee fiscal responsibilities for Les Evans since ESC 11 will serve as the fiscal agent for the Association. ARTICLE V AMENDMENTS This constitution and the attached By-Laws may be amended at any regular meeting by a two-thirds vote of the membership present, provided the proposed amendment has been presented in writing to the secretary and membership present at the preceding regular meeting. ARTICLE VI BY-LAWS Robert s Rules of Order, Revised or Gregg s Parliamentary Law shall be the authority on all questions of procedure not specifically stated in this Constitution and By-Laws. The By-Laws shall regulate details of the activities of the Association. These may be amended (1) at any meeting for the transaction of official business by a majority vote of the members present, or (2) by a mail vote of majority of the members replying, providing in either case that notice has been given sixty days previous to the time of voting.
3 BY-LAWS ARTICLE I DUTIES AND TERMS OF OFFICERS All officers shall take office on the first day of June and serve for two years. In case a vacancy in an office occurs it shall be filled by the executive committee, excepting the office of president, and the person so chosen shall serve to the end of the expired term. The president shall preside at all meetings of the Association and of the executive committee; shall appoint all committees not otherwise provided for and be an ex officio member of all committees except the nominating committee; and shall approve all official communications sent out in the name of the Association. The vice-president shall assume the duties of the president in case of absence or resignation of the president; shall be chairman of the program committee; and send out notices of meetings. Section 4 The secretary shall keep a record of all meetings of the Association and of the executive committee; shall prepare and keep on file a correct list of the names and addresses of the members of the executive committee; shall notify the Texas Association for Supervision and Curriculum Development of any changes of officers in the Association; and shall be responsible for official correspondence. Section 5 The treasurer shall be responsible for the collection of all dues; shall have charge of all funds of the Association; shall deposit them in the name of the Association through ESC Region 11, who will serve as the fiscal agent as approved by the executive committee; and shall disperse them as authorized by the executive committee. The treasurer also shall be responsible for preparing and keeping on file a correct list of members of the organization. Section 6 The immediate past president shall serve in an advisory capacity to the executive committee, shall coordinate the selection of the Excellence in Teaching award winners; and shall chair the nominating committee.
4 Section 7 In addition to duties specified elsewhere in the Constitution and By-Laws, all other officers shall perform functions incumbent upon them as provided in the Constitution and By-Laws. ARTICLE II EXECUTIVE COMMITTEE Upon the executive committee shall rest, in the interim of the regular meeting, the duties, responsibilities, and final authority for the conduct of the Association in all matter except as stated otherwise in the Constitution and By-Laws or as maybe referred to it by the Association. The meetings of the executive committee shall be held at the call of the president or at the call of the majority of the executive committee. It shall be the duty of the committee to act upon matters of business, which are to be presented at the regular meetings of the Association, and to fill vacancies, which may arise between meetings. Official yearly affiliate relationships between the Leslie P. Evans Chapter and Texas ASCD shall be the responsibility of the executive committee. ARTICLE III COMMITTEE The president who shall be ex officio member of all committees except the nominating committee shall appoint standing and special committees of the Association. At the last chapter meeting of the school year, the president shall appoint an audit committee, consisting of two members not from the ESC Region 11 where the treasurer works, to review the financial records of the organization. The audit committee will report to the membership at the first meeting of the following school year.
5 ARTICLE IV MEETINGS A minimum of three meetings of the Association shall be held in accordance with the actions of the executive committee subject to the wishes of the membership. The president, with the consent of the executive committee, shall have power to change the date of meetings. Special meetings shall be held at the call of the president; or the president shall call a special meeting for a specific purpose upon the written request of five members. The order of business shall be as follows unless changed by a vote of those present: 1) Opening remarks by president 2) Secretary s report 3) Treasurer s report 4) Report of standing committees 5) Unfinished business 6) New business 7) Program 8) Announcements ARTICLE V DUES The annual dues for this Association shall be decided by vote of the membership in attendance at a regular meeting. Annual dues shall entitle each member to membership from September 1 to August 31, and dues shall be paid by November 1 of each year. ARTICLE VI NOMINATIONS AND ELECTIONS Officers of the Association shall be elected in the following manner; a nominating committee of three shall be appointed at the next-to-last regular meeting of the Association; at the last meeting it shall present a slate of officers to be voted on in a manner to be decided. No two persons from the same district or education entity will be asked to serve as officers on the executive committee.
6 Additional nominations may be made from the floor provided the nominee s consent is secured before the vote is taken.
